I had some NAVCoin from a few months ago, and sort of forgot about them. Yesterday, I realized that over the past few months, with the rise in price as well as the ongoing staking, i built up a nice little balance. However, as I restarted my computer, the wallet crashed and wouldn't re-open. So I re-installed the latest version of the NAV wallet, replaced my wallet.dat file, downloaded the blockchain, synched the wallet... -and I got it to function eventually, but my balance showed 0. Then I repaired the wallet, and I finally got a balance, but only half of what it was yesterday. I figure half is better than nothing, but is there anything more I can do to restore my full balance?
Thanks you for any thoughts/advice...!
EDIT: Well, the wallet was 'stable' for the time it took me to write the above post. It just crashed again:
Error: A fatal internal error occurred, see debug.log for details
Back to the beginning, I suppose.... -this is tying....
2nd EDIT: repeated the process... back with half the balance... -until the next crash i suppose...?
